Colebrook, NH – May 06, 2026 — HR Rebooted, a leader in human resources strategy and workforce innovation, today announced the launch of MyCareer Navigator, an AI-powered tool that helps individuals understand how AI may affect their jobs and what steps they can take to build stronger, future-ready careers. The platform gives users clear disruption-risk insights, skill assessments, and practical tools to map career pathways, strengthen AI resilience, and prepare for long-term growth.

MyCareer Navigator gives partner organizations a practical, scalable way to help people navigate AI-driven workforce change. Workforce boards, staffing firms, education providers, career-services teams, and employer-focused organizations can integrate the platform into their advising, coaching, and training programs to deliver clear, data-driven guidance at scale.

The platform brings together disruption-risk insights, skill assessment, role matching, and career-building tools in one place, giving partners a structured way to support clients, students, and job seekers as they navigate an evolving labor market.

With MyCareer Navigator, partners can offer their communities the ability to:

  • Take an AI Disruption Risk Assessment for their current job

  • View a personalized risk score and the factors driving it

  • Rate their skills and receive an AI-resilience score

  • Build a transition plan that identifies roles aligned with their skills, risk reduction, and salary potential

  • Browse and search AI-risk data across all roles

  • Explore skills-building opportunities using courses and certifications from their own organization or preferred providers

  • Upload, build, and refine a resume, including comparisons against job descriptions

  • Practice interview questions with AI-powered feedback
